У меня есть приложение, в котором я пытался реализовать пользовательскую камеру. Это исходный код:Пользовательская камера iOS

AVCaptureVideoPreviewLayer *captureVideoPreviewLayer = [[AVCaptureVideoPreviewLayer alloc] initWithSession:session]; 

    captureVideoPreviewLayer.frame = self.vImagePreview.bounds; 
    [self.vImagePreview.layer addSublayer:captureVideoPreviewLayer]; 

    AVCaptureDevice *device = [AVCaptureDevice defaultDeviceWithMediaType:AVMediaTypeVideo]; 
    //device.position ; 
    NSError *error = nil; 
    AVCaptureDeviceInput *input = [AVCaptureDeviceInput deviceInputWithDevice:device error:&error]; 
    [session addInput:input]; 
    [session startRunning]; 

    stillImageOutput = [[AVCaptureStillImageOutput alloc] init]; 
    NSDictionary *outputSettings = [[NSDictionary alloc] initWithObjectsAndKeys: AVVideoCodecJPEG, AVVideoCodecKey, nil]; 
    [stillImageOutput setOutputSettings:outputSettings]; 

    [session addOutput:stillImageOutput]; 

Затем я попытался создать снимок и отправить его на другой контроллер вида:

-(IBAction) captureNow 
{ 
    AVCaptureConnection *videoConnection = nil; 
    for (AVCaptureConnection *connection in stillImageOutput.connections) 
    { 
     for (AVCaptureInputPort *port in [connection inputPorts]) 
     { 
      if ([[port mediaType] isEqual:AVMediaTypeVideo]) 
      { 
       videoConnection = connection; 
       break; 
      } 
     } 
     if (videoConnection) { break; } 
    } 

    //NSLog(@"about to request a capture from: %@", stillImageOutput); 

    AcceptingPhotoViewController *photo = [[AcceptingPhotoViewController alloc] initWithNibName:@"AcceptingPhotoViewController" bundle:nil]; 

    [stillImageOutput captureStillImageAsynchronouslyFromConnection:videoConnection completionHandler: ^(CMSampleBufferRef imageSampleBuffer, NSError *error) 
    { 
     CFDictionaryRef exifAttachments = CMGetAttachment(imageSampleBuffer, kCGImagePropertyExifDictionary, NULL); 

     NSData *imageData = [AVCaptureStillImageOutput jpegStillImageNSDataRepresentation:imageSampleBuffer]; 
     UIImage *image = [[UIImage alloc] initWithData:imageData]; 

     photo.image = [[UIImage alloc] init ]; 
     photo.image = image; 
     photo.photoFromCamera = YES; 

     [self.navigationController pushViewController:photo animated:NO]; 
    }]; 
} 

Но в моем целевом классе это изображение вращается влево на 90 градусов: enter image description here

Я попытался повернуть его обратно:

float newSide = MAX([image size].width, [image size].height); 
        CGSize size = CGSizeMake(newSide, newSide); 
        UIGraphicsBeginImageContext(size); 
        CGContextRef ctx = UIGraphicsGetCurrentContext(); 
        CGContextTranslateCTM(ctx, newSide/2, newSide/2); 
        CGContextRotateCTM(ctx, 1.57079633); 
        CGContextDrawImage(UIGraphicsGetCurrentContext(),CGRectMake(-[image size].width/2,-[image size].height/2,size.width, size.height),image.CGImage); 
        UIImage *i = UIGraphicsGetImageFromCurrentImageContext(); 
        UIGraphicsEndImageContext(); 
        image = i; 

Мое изображение повернуто справа, но оно отображается зеркально и растягивается.

Любая помощь? Могу ли я повернуть другим способом, или, может быть, я должен сделать фотографию не так?

Я нашел решение этой проблемы:

Я вращать и преобразовать изображение таким образом

UIView* rotatedViewBox = [[UIView alloc] initWithFrame: CGRectMake(0, 0, image.size.width, image.size.height)]; 
        float angleRadians = 90 * ((float)M_PI/180.0f); 
        CGAffineTransform t = CGAffineTransformMakeRotation(angleRadians); 
        rotatedViewBox.transform = t; 
        CGSize rotatedSize = rotatedViewBox.frame.size; 

       UIGraphicsBeginImageContext(rotatedSize); 
       CGContextRef bitmap = UIGraphicsGetCurrentContext(); 
       CGContextTranslateCTM(bitmap, rotatedSize.width/2, rotatedSize.height/2); 
       CGContextRotateCTM(bitmap, angleRadians); 

       CGContextScaleCTM(bitmap, 1.0, -1.0); 
       CGContextDrawImage(bitmap, CGRectMake(-image.size.width/2, -image.size.height/2, image.size.width, image.size.height), [image CGImage]); 

       UIImage *newImage = UIGraphicsGetImageFromCurrentImageContext(); 
       UIGraphicsEndImageContext(); 
       image = newImage; 

       CGSize newSize = CGSizeMake(image.size.height, image.size.width); 
       UIGraphicsBeginImageContext(newSize); 

       // Tell the old image to draw in this new context, with the desired 
       // new size 
       [image drawInRect:CGRectMake(0,0,image.size.height,image.size.width)]; 

       // Get the new image from the context 
       UIImage* newImage2 = UIGraphicsGetImageFromCurrentImageContext(); 

       // End the context 
       UIGraphicsEndImageContext(); 

       image = newImage2;

Попробуйте этот код он будет помогает U ..

- (UIImage *)fixrotation:(UIImage *)image{ 
    if (image.imageOrientation == UIImageOrientationDown) return image; 
CGAffineTransform transform = CGAffineTransformIdentity; 

switch (image.imageOrientation) { 
    case UIImageOrientationDown: 
    case UIImageOrientationDownMirrored: 
     transform = CGAffineTransformTranslate(transform, image.size.width, image.size.height); 
     transform = CGAffineTransformRotate(transform, M_PI); 
     break; 

    case UIImageOrientationLeft: 
    case UIImageOrientationLeftMirrored: 
     transform = CGAffineTransformTranslate(transform, image.size.width, 0); 
     transform = CGAffineTransformRotate(transform, M_PI_2); 
     break; 

    case UIImageOrientationRight: 
    case UIImageOrientationRightMirrored: 
     transform = CGAffineTransformTranslate(transform, 0, image.size.height); 
     transform = CGAffineTransformRotate(transform, -M_PI_2); 
     break; 
    case UIImageOrientationUp: 
    case UIImageOrientationUpMirrored: 
     break; 
} 

switch (image.imageOrientation) { 
    case UIImageOrientationUpMirrored: 
    case UIImageOrientationDownMirrored: 
     transform = CGAffineTransformTranslate(transform, image.size.width, 0); 
     transform = CGAffineTransformScale(transform, -1, 1); 
     break; 

    case UIImageOrientationLeftMirrored: 
    case UIImageOrientationRightMirrored: 
     transform = CGAffineTransformTranslate(transform, image.size.height, 0); 
     transform = CGAffineTransformScale(transform, -1, 1); 
     break; 
    case UIImageOrientationUp: 
    case UIImageOrientationDown: 
    case UIImageOrientationLeft: 
    case UIImageOrientationRight: 
     break; 
} 

// Now we draw the underlying CGImage into a new context, applying the transform 
// calculated above. 
CGContextRef ctx = CGBitmapContextCreate(NULL, image.size.width, image.size.height, 
             CGImageGetBitsPerComponent(image.CGImage), 0, 
             CGImageGetColorSpace(image.CGImage), 
             CGImageGetBitmapInfo(image.CGImage)); 
CGContextConcatCTM(ctx, transform); 
switch (image.imageOrientation) { 
    case UIImageOrientationLeft: 
    case UIImageOrientationLeftMirrored: 
    case UIImageOrientationRight: 
    case UIImageOrientationRightMirrored: 
     // Grr... 
     CGContextDrawImage(ctx, CGRectMake(0,0,image.size.height,image.size.width), image.CGImage); 
     break; 

    default: 
     CGContextDrawImage(ctx, CGRectMake(0,0,image.size.width,image.size.height), image.CGImage); 
     break; 
} 

// And now we just create a new UIImage from the drawing context 
CGImageRef cgimg = CGBitmapContextCreateImage(ctx); 
UIImage *img = [UIImage imageWithCGImage:cgimg]; 
CGContextRelease(ctx); 
CGImageRelease(cgimg); 
return img; 

}
